ABSTRACT:
A fuel injection amount computing unit for an internal combustion engine is disclosed, wherein when an intake air flow Qho as calculated from a throttle valve opening degree and an engine speed is greater than a predetermined value, and when a variation .DELTA.Tp.sub.REAL of a smoothed basic fuel injection amount Tp.sub.REAL is negative and a final basic fuel injection amount AvTp including phase adjustment and prefetched correction is greater than a trimmed basic fuel injection amount TrTp (=Tp.sub.REAL .times.Ktrm), a surging smoothing index ND is switched from a value (0; smoothing prohibited) corresponding to the transient state to a value (3; smoothing maximized) corresponding to the fully open state.
